In a RGB color space, hex #e5ab68 is composed of 89.8% red, 67.1%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 25.3% magenta, 54.6%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 32.2 degrees, a saturation of 70.6% and a lightness of 65.3%. #e5ab68 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ffd0 with #cb5700. Closest websafe color is: #cc9966.

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#100a03 is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.
